Alot of people dont like the cvt because of the way the car performs with the trans you cant hear shift.It takes a little getting use to but after a while you will not even notice.They are quick and reliable.My 07 maxima has 44k on it and i drive the hell out of it sometimes over 100 miles a day and problem free.I just keep up with every 3k miles oil changes and always use shells VPOWER gas preferable choice or pump premium gas at any other gas station,And it runs like a champ.Look at kevin007 cvt maxima running high 13s just with a fujita and catback.
